Abstract

A light shield () for blocking light traveling toward a PIN photodiode () from a glass substrate () side is formed of a conductive material, and a reference electric potential (Vr−nVoc) equal to that of a cathode of the PIN photodiode () is applied to the light shield () from a power supply circuit (). Thus, inductive noise for a photoelectric conversion device used for an ambient light sensor is further reduced in a display device.
